轻松学会查看数据库sid (怎么看数据库sid)
在进行数据库操作的过程中,我们经常需要查看数据库的sid。sid是数据库的唯一标识符,是在创建数据库的过程中自动生成的,用于区分不同的数据库。如果不知道数据库的sid,我们就无法进行对应的数据库操作。本文将介绍在不同系统下如何查看数据库的sid,并为读者提供一些实用技巧。
一、Windows系统下查看数据库sid
1. 使用Oracle Universal Installer
Oracle Universal Installer是Oracle公司开发的一款可视化安装工具,可以用来安装和管理Oracle软件,并提供了一些实用工具。在Windows系统下,我们可以使用Oracle Universal Installer来查看数据库的sid。
我们需要打开Oracle Universal Installer。在安装选项页面,选择“Oracle产品的安装、再安装或添加新的功能”。
接着,在产品安装页面选择“Oracle数据库11g”。注意,这里的版本需要与本地安装的Oracle数据库版本一致。
在下一步“选择安装类型”页面中选择“自定义”,然后在“Oracle软件集”页面上选择“Oracle Database 11g”。
继续向下滚动,我们可以看到“选择数据库管理选项”页面。在其中,我们可以看到“选择一个管理选项”,然后选择“新建数据库”。
在“数据库配置”页面中,我们可以看到“SID”字段,这个字段就是我们需要查看的数据库sid。
2. 使用Oracle Net Configuration Assistant
Oracle Net Configuration Assistant是Oracle公司开发的一款可视化网络配置工具,可以用来配置和管理Oracle网络服务。在Windows系统下,我们也可以使用Oracle Net Configuration Assistant来查看数据库的sid。
我们需要打开Oracle Net Configuration Assistant。在主菜单中选择“本地配置”。
然后,选择“使用现有的Net Service命名”,并在列表中选择现有的Net Service。
在下一个页面中,我们可以看到“服务名称”的字段,这个字段就是对应的数据库sid。
二、Linux系统下查看数据库sid
1. 使用Linux命令
在Linux系统下我们可以使用以下命令来查看数据库的sid:
$ echo $ORACLE_SID
这个命令会输出当前环境的ORACLE_SID变量值,就是对应的数据库sid。
2. 直接查看监听程序
在Linux系统下,我们还可以直接查看监听程序来获取对应的数据库sid。通过以下命令启动监听程序:
$ lsnrctl start
然后,在Oracle Home目录下执行以下命令:
$ cd $ORACLE_HOME/network/admin
$ vi tnsnames.ora
在tnsnames.ora配置文件中,可以看到数据库的sid信息。
三、Mac系统下查看数据库sid
在Mac系统下,我们可以使用如下命令来查看数据库sid:
$ echo $ORACLE_SID
这个命令与Linux系统下的命令类似,在终端执行即可获取当前环境的ORACLE_SID变量值,就是对应的数据库sid。
四、其他实用技巧
除了以上方法外,我们还可以通过Oracle SQL Developer的“连接信息”来查看数据库的sid。在Oracle SQL Developer中,选择需要连接的数据库,在“连接信息”中即可看到对应的数据库sid。此外,我们还可以使用SQL*Plus或者Enterprise Manager等工具来查看数据库的sid。
本文介绍了在Windows、Linux和Mac系统下如何查看数据库的sid,希望能为读者提供帮助。此外,我们还介绍了一些相关的实用技巧,希望能够方便读者进行数据库操作。在实际操作中,我们需要根据自己的需求选择合适的方法来查看数据库的sid,以便进行相应的数据库操作。